What'sabetterteachingmethod?JimMunch'sexperienceLASTspring,whenhewas
onlyasophomore,JimMunchreceivedaplaquehonoringhimastopscoreronthehigh
schoolmathteamhere.Hewentontoearnthehighestmarkpossible,a5,onan
AdvancedPlacementexamincalculus.Hisambitionistobecomeatheoretical
mathematician.SoJimmighthaveseemedtheveritablesymbolforthenewmath
curriculuminstalledoverthelastsevenyearsinthisambitious,educatedsuburbof
Rochester.Sinceseventhgrade,hehadbeentakingthe"constructivist"or"inquiry"
program,sonamedbecauseitemphasizespupils'constructingtheirownknowledge
throughaprocessofreasoning.Jim,however,placedthecreditelsewhere.Hisparents,an
engineerandaneducator,covertlytutoredhimintraditionalmath.Severalteachers,in
theprivacyoftheirownclassrooms,contravenedtheofficialcurriculumtoteachthe
problem-solvingformulasthatconstructivistmathdenigratesasmindlessmemorization.
"Mywholeexperienceinmaththelastfewyearshasbeenastruggleagainstthe
program,"Jimsaidrecently."WhateverI'veachieved,I'veachievedinspiteofit.Kidsdo
notdobetterlearningmaththemselves.There'sareasonwegotoschool,whichisthat
there'ssomeonesmarterthanuswithsomethingtoteachus."Theconstructivistmath
Suchexperiencesandemotionshaveburstintopublicdiscussionandnosmallamountof
rancor(怨恨)inthelasteightmonthsinPenfield.Thiscommunityof35000hasbecome
oneofthemostobviousfrontsinthenationwidemathwars,whichhaveflaredfrom
CaliforniatoPittsburghtotheformerDistrict2ontheUpperEastSideofManhattan,
pittingprogressivesagainsttraditionalists,withnothinglessthanAmerica'seducational
andeconomiccompetitivenessatstake.Intheseplacesandothers,groupsofparentshave
condemnedconstructivistmathforplayingdownsuchbasiccomputationaltoolsas
borrowing,carrying,placevalue,algorithms,multiplicationtablesandlongdivision,
whileoftenintroducingcalculatorsintotheclassroomasearlyasfirstorsecondgrade.
SuchcriticismhasrunheadlongintothecelebrationofconstructivismbytheNational
CouncilofTeachersofMathematicsandsuchleadingteacher-traininginstitutionsasthe
BankStreetCollegeofEducation.Thestrifehastakenonaparticularintensityherein
Penfield,perhaps,becausethetownincludesanunusuallylargeshareofengineersand
scientists,becauseoftheproximity(接近)ofcompanieslikeXerox,KodakandBausch&
Lomb.Skilledthemselvesinmath,theyhaverefusedtoacceptthepremisethat
innovationmeansimprovement,andintheirownhouseholdstheyhaveseenevidenceto
thecontrary.ForJoeHoover,theepiphanycametwoyearsagowhenhetookhis
daughter,Kathryn,theninsixthgrade,tolunchatMcDonald'sandrealizedshecouldnot
computethecorrectchangefortheirmealfroma$20bill.ForClaudiaLioy,itwas
seeingherdaughter,Iris,theninthirdgrade,ploddingthroughamultiplicationproblem
bycounting23groupsoffourapples.WhenMrs.LioypleadedwithIris'steachersimply
toshowtheclassatimestable,theteacherreplied,"Butthat'sdrill-and-kilL"ForBen
Lee,itwashavinghisteenagedaughter,Oliviatryingtoanswerprobabilityproblemsby
amethodcalled"guessandcheck"-untilhepulledouthisown1Othgrademathbookto
instructherabouttheappropriateformula."Idon'tmindhavingkidsappreciatewhatthey
learn,"saidMr.Lee,anengineerwhonowworksasapurchasingagentforKodak."But
it'scrazytomakeakidspendanighttryingtosolveaproblemwiththeserudimentary
andfeebletools."RequestsformoretraditionalmathBylastspring,theseparentshad
discoveredoneanotherandtheircommonexasperationwithconstructivistmath.Jim
Munch'sfather,Bill,asoftwaredeveloperatKodak,drewupapetitionaskingthe
Penfieldschoolstoofferpupilstheoptionoftakingtraditionalmath.Nearly700residents
signedit.LastJune,theBoardofEducationturneddowntherequest.Thesupportersof
theconstructivistsNotsurprising,schoolofficialsherepaintawildlydifferentpictureof
thenewmathcurriculumthandothecriticalparents.TheypointtoaslipinPenfield's
scoresonstandardizedmathtestsandRegentsexamsinthelate1990'sasacatalyst(催化
剂I)forchangingtheprogram.Theyalsonotethatsincetheintroductionofthe
constructivistcurriculums-Investigationsforelementaryschool,ConnectedMathfor
juniorhigh,CorePlusforhighschool-thosescoreshaverisengraduallybutsteadily.In
abroadsense,Penfieldcanbeahardplacetomaketheindictmentagainstconstructivism
stick.Thehighschoolsends90percentofitsgraduatestotwo-yearorfour-yearcolleges,
andthemeanSATscorestandsal1117(with562onmath).Intliebattleofanecdotes,
schoolofficialsassembledtheirownarrayofparentstopraisethenewcurriculumwhen
thiscolumnistvisitedPenfieldlastweek.SusanGray,thesuperintendent,attributedthe
criticismofthemathprogramto"helicopterparents"whoareaccustomedtobeingdeeply
involvedinallaspectsoftheirchildren'slives."Becausethepedagogyhaschanged,the
parentswhoknewtheoldwaysdidn'tknowhowtohelptheirchildren,'1shesaid."They
didn'thavetheknowledgeandskillstosupporttheirchildrenathome.There'sasecurity
inmemorizationofmathfacts,andthatsecurityisgonenow."Thecontroversialopinion
overconstructivistprogramYETmanyofthedissident(持不同政见者)parentshave
extensivemathbackgroundsandthustheabilitytocriticizethecurriculum.Itisalsotrue
thatmostofthemtoleratedtheconstructivistprogramforitsfirstseveralyears,until
bitterexperiencedrovethemintorebellion.MaryRapp,theassistantsuperintendent,
acknowledgedthelegitimacyofsomecomplaints.Inresponse,shesaid,Penfieldhas
begunsupplementingtheconstructivistclasseswithlessonsincomputation.Nearly300
pupilsinthedistrictarenowreceivingremedialclasses.Agroupofteachersworkedlast
summertorevisethemathsyllabusinthehighschoolinasomewhatmoreconventional
direction.Asaresult,thedistricthashadtopetitionthestateforapostponementinthe
MathARegemsexam,fromearly2006toJune.Still,inthemathwars,tweakingaround
theedgesdoesnotsettletheissue.Thedisputeisfundamental.Toitsadvocates,
constructivistmathappliesthesubjecttotherealworld,buildscriticalthinkingand
rescuesclassesfromnumbingrepetition.ButtothoseparentsinPenfieldandelsewhere—
whohavechildreninjuniorhighunabletodolongdivisionormultiplytwo-column
numbers,whopayfbrprivatetutorsorsessionsattraditionalistlearningcenterslike
Kumon,whowonderwhytherearesomanycalculatorsandsofewtextbooks-thev/ords
ofarecentgraduatetotheBoardofEducationringtragicallytrue."Mybiggestfearabout
goingtocollege,'*SamanthaMeeksaidatameetinglastspring,"isattendingintroductory
mathcourses.HowamIgoingtobeableioexplaintomyprofessorsihaiIdonoi
understandwhattheyaretalkingabout,thatIdonothavethesamemathbackgroundas
therestofthestudents,andthatIcannotdomentalmathandcanbarelydoitwithpencil
andpaper?"

Desperatelyshortoflivingspaceand[Cl]pronetoflooding,theNetherlands
planstostartbuildinghomes,businessesandevenroadsonwaler.Withnearlyathirdof
thecountryalreadycoveredbywaterandhalfofitslandmassbelowsealeveland
constantlyunderthreatfromrisingwaters,the[C2]believethatfloating
communitiesmaywellbethefuture.Sixprototypewoodenandaluminumfloating
housesarealready[C3]tosomethingoffAmsterdam,andatleastafurther100
areplannedonthesameestatecalledIjburg."Everybodyaskswhydidn'twedothiskind
ofthingbefore,"saidGijsbertVanderWoerdt,directorofthefirmresponsiblefor
promotingtheconcept."AfterBangladesh,we'rethemost[C4]populated
countryintheworld.Buildingspaceisscarceandgovernmentstudiesshowthatwell
needtodoublethespace[C5]tousinthecomingyearstomeetallourneeds."
Beforebeingplacedonthewaterandmovedintopositionbytugboats(拖船),thehouses
arcbuiltonlandatopconcretefiat-bottomedboats,whichencasegiantlumpsof
polystyrene(聚苯乙烯)【C6】withsteel.Theflat-bottomedboatsaresaidtobe
unsinkableandareanchoredbyunderwatercables.Thefloatingroadsapplythesame
technology.Theconceptisproving[C7]withtheDutch.Thewaitinglistfor
suchhomes,whichwillcostbetweeneuros200000-500000tobuy,runsupto5000
names,claimedVandcrWocrdt.Withmuchofthecountrygivenovertomarket
gardeningandtheintensivecultivationofflowersandvegetables,plannershavealso
comeupwithdesignsforfloatinggreenhousesdesignedsothatthewater[C8]
themirrigatestheplantsandcontrolsthetemperatureinside.Apilotproject,covering50
hectaresoffloodedlandnearAmsterdam'sSchipholairport,is[C9]for2005.
Theopportunitiesforinnovativedeveloperslook[CIO]."Wehave10projects
inthepipeline-Hoatingvillagesandcitiescompletewithoffices,shopsandrestaurants,"

TheestablishmentoftheThirdReichinfluencedeventsinAmericanhistorybystartinga
chainofevents,whichculminatedinwarbetweenGermanyandtheUnitedStates.The
completedestructionofdemocracy,thepersecutionofJews,thewaronreligion,the
crueltyandbarbarismoftheNazis,andespeciallytheplansofGermanyandherallies,
ItalyandJapan,forworldconquestcausedgreatindignationinthiscountryandbrought
onfearofanotherworldwar.WhilespeakingoutagainstHitler'satrocities(暴行),the
Americanpeoplegenerallyfavoredisolationistpoliciesandneutrality.TheNeutrality
Actsof1935and1936prohibitedtradewithanybelligerentsorloanstothem.In1937,
thePresidentwasempoweredtodeclareanarmsembargoinwarsbetweennationsathis
discretion.AmericanopinionbegantochangesomewhatafterPresidentRoosevelt's
"quarantinetheaggressor"speechatChicago(1937)inwhichheseverelycriticized
Hitler'spolicies.Germany'sseizureofAustriaandtheMunichPactforthepartitionof
Czechoslovakia(1938)alsoarousedtheAmericanpeople.Theconquestof
CzechoslovakiainMarch,1939wasanotherrudeawakeningtothemenaceoftheThird
Reich.InAugust,1939cametheshockoftheNazi-sovietPactandinSeptemberthe
attackonPolandandtheoutbreakofEuropeanwar.TheUnitedStatesattemptedto
maintainneutralityinspiteofsympathyforthedemocraciesarrayedagainsttheThird
Reich.TheNeutralityActof1939repealedthearmsembargoandpermitted"cashand
carry"exportsofarmstobelligerentnations.Astrongnationaldefenseprogramwas
begun.Adraftactwaspassed(1940)tostrengthenthemilitaryservices.ALendAct
(1941)authorizedthePresidenttosell,exchange,orlendmaterialstoanycountry
deemednecessarybyhimforthedefenseoftheUnitedStates.HelpwasgiventoBritain
byexchangingcertainoveragedestroyersfbrtherighttoestablishAmericanbasesin
BritishterritoryintheWesternHemisphere.InAugust,1940,PresidentRooseveltand
PrimeMinisterChurchillmetandissuedtheAtlanticCharterwhichproclaimedthekind
ofaworldwhichshouldbeestablishedafterthewar.InDecember,1941,Japanlaunched
theunprovokedattackontheUnitedStatesatPearlHarbor.Immediatelythereafter,
GermanydeclaredwarontheUnitedStates.
